Craft: J is for Jester
- Print template on heavy paper or cardstock
- Cut out pieces (J body, head, hat, hands)
- Color pieces
- Glue head to top of J
- Glue hat to top of head
- Glue hands to sides of J





Extension Activities:
- Take a field trip to an ice cream store.  Try a new flavor of ice cream.
- Practice counting and sorting with jelly beans.
- Make and decorate a kite.  Directions of several easy kites to make can be found online.

Craft: Paper Sun Kite
The template for this kite can be found online at http://www.ict.griffith.edu.au/anthony/kites/paper_sun.gif.  The children colored the cutout kite, folded and glued as instructed, and glued on crepe paper streamers.  I then hole punched for string that could be added at home.

Literacy Extensions:
- Use alphabet flash cards, asking your child to give the sound of each letter as it is shown.
- After reading the book Dinosaur Kisses, see if your child can break down the steps and tell how to give a kiss as if the person doesn't know what a kiss is.
